I'm using cygwin to window into a Solaris box.

I have this setup on my desktop computer (Windows 2000) and it works fine.
I attempted to do the same thing on my laptop and it fails if I try to 
bring up the "textedit" editor.
however it works for xterm, and some other applications.

I'm using startxwin.bat to startup the X-session.
    it's doing a:
         start XWin -multiwindow -clipboard
           run xterm -s1 1000 -sb -rightbar -ms -red -fg yellow -bg black 
-e /usr/bin/bash -l



the error I see is:

X Error (intercepted): BadWindow (invalid Window parameter)
Major Request Code:   7
Minor Request Code:   0
Resource ID (XID):       58
Error Serial Number:    48
XView warning:  invalid object (not a pointer), xv_get
finished; X Error of failed request:  BadWindow (invalid Window parameter)
    Major opcode of failed request:   7 (X_ReparentWindow)
    Resource id in failed request:  0x3a
    Serial number of failed request:  48
    Current serial number in output stream:  57

-------------------------
this also works someones and fails other times.

We've reloaded cygwin a couple times to make sure we had the latest software.
